Disciple

Christian hard rock outfit Disciple was shaped in 1992 by friends Kevin Little, Brad Noah, Tim Barrett, and Adrian DiTommasi (who leave the group shorty after inception) so that they can spread the Gospel while playing the noisy, metallic music they cherished. Over time, their style advanced into one much like many secular substitute metal groups, because they toured churches, high institutions, colleges, and equivalent locations. Their self-released debut, THAT WHICH WAS I Thinking, arrived in 1995, accompanied by an EP, My Daddy Can Whip Your Daddy, on Warner Resound in 1997. Their sophomore full-length work, THIS MAY Sting a bit, followed 2 yrs later on Tough Information. By God implemented in 2001 on a single label. 2003’s AGAIN found the music group on a fresh label, their very own indie Slain Information. That season, the trio became a quartet by adding bassist Joey Fife with their lineup. The group agreed upon with INO Information the following season and released a self-titled LP in June of 2005. Marks Remain appeared on Integrity in past due 2006. After many years of nominations, the record won the music group their initial Dove Prize for Rock and roll Album of the entire year. In 2008, Noah and Fife stepped down in the music group and their places were packed by bassist Israel Beachy and guitarists Andrew Welch and Micah Sannan. Southern Hospitality showed up later that 12 months. Before their following launch, founding drummer Tim Barrett would also component methods with Disciple, changed by Trent Reiff. Horseshoes & Hands Grenades, Disciple’s 8th LP, in Apr 2010. It topped the Christian graph and came into the Billboard Best 50. Because the band’s recognition grew, they embarked on a small number of tours with additional top Christian functions like Thousand Feet Krutch and Skillet. 2012 noticed the discharge of O God Conserve Us All, and a flurry of line-up adjustments. After four years with Disciple, Welch remaining the band to become listed on Thousand Feet Krutch, while Sannan and Beachy had been changed by Josiah Prince (Philmont) and Jason Wilkes (Large Flight Culture). By early 2013, Reiff exited and was changed by Joey Western. Andrew Stanton also became a member of the band, departing Young because the just initial member. The refreshed quintet forged forward using the crowd-funded discharge of 2014’s Strike, that was their highest Billboard 200 entrance up to now, peaking at amount 44. Made by longtime Disciple manufacturer Travis Wyrick, Strike also increased to the quantity two spots in the Hard Rock and roll and Christian graphs. It might be the very first and last record with Wilkes on bass, who still left the band another season. Vultures, a six-song EP documented during the Strike sessions, premiered by the end of 2015. Another EP, Reside in Denmark, appeared the following season, along with a group of concert movies from Denmark’s RiverFest. The music group — today a quartet — released another crowd-funded work in 2016. Their eleventh record, Longer Live the Rebels debuted at amount 125, rendering it the band’s 6th Billboard 200 entrance to date.
